Abstract:
Methods, systems, and devices for wireless communication are described. In some aspects, a user equipment (UE) may identify a resource block set that includes a data region and a control region, wherein the resource block set spans a portion of a system bandwidth in a shortened transmission time interval (sTTI), wherein the sTTI includes three symbols, wherein the control region occupies the three symbols and includes control information for the UE for the sTTI, and wherein the control region and the data region are frequency division multiplexed. The UE may obtain content in the sTTI based at least in part on the control information. Numerous other aspects are provided.
